| Reverse description | Central motif depicts a raised relief map of the Central American isthmus, shown in geographic orientation with Mexico visible to the upper left and the landmass tapering toward Panama at the lower right. The motto 'DIOS · UNION · LIBERTAD' arcs across the upper periphery. In the lower field, a circular cartouche bears the proposed monetary symbol '$CA' surrounded by the inscription 'UNA MONEDA PARA TODOS', referencing the ODECA's aspiration for a unified Central American currency. |
